EPA | HEPA | ULPA filters
Aluminum frame | Construction depth 150 mm | Pleat depth 50 mm | HEPA
Specifications
Filter medium Micro-glass-fiber paper
Recommended final pressure drop 600 Pa
Thermal stability 70 °C
Moisture resistance 100 % rel. hum.
Frame Extruded aluminum profile, anodized
Seal Semicircular PU profile, endlessly foamed
Protection grids On both sides, aluminum, powder-coated

Viledon HEPA filters are microbiologically inactive and meet all hygiene
requirements of the German VDI Guideline 6022 “Hygiene requirements for
HVAC systems and units”.
Easy handling and mounting thanks to high twist strength.
The filter elements feature protection grids on both sides made of powder-
coated expanded metal.
